ANECDOTE

Sega's Rise

  • Sega, with the Genesis, captured 50% of the US video game market share, rivaling Nintendo.
  • This was an unexpected success, as Sega started as an underdog.
INSIGHT

CD-ROMs and Add-ons

  • CD-ROMs were the future, offering more storage and lower production costs than cartridges.
  • The industry mistakenly believed add-on peripherals were the way to adopt CDs.
ANECDOTE

Sega CD Flop

  • Sega launched the Sega CD with the controversial game Night Trap, a full-motion video game.
  • Despite initial interest, the Sega CD flopped, selling only 3 million units compared to the Genesis's 30 million.
